dyebath and auxiliary bath reuse for energy and mass conservation

dyebath/auxiliary bath reuse are demonstrated on a pilot-scale to be a feasible, economical alternative to conventional batch dyeing processes. atmospheric disperse dyeing of nylon and polyester carpet and nylon pantyhose, and pressure disperse dyeing of polyester yarn packages have all been demonstrated as suitable candidates for plant incorporation of the reuse techniques. good lot-to-lot shade correlations were also obtained with reuse of low-temperature reactive dyebaths and fixation baths on 100 cotton, and with reuse of combined high-energy reactive/disperse dyebaths and fixation baths on cotton/polyester knit fabrics. further computer program development is required, however, before industrial shades can be matched with the reactive dye reuse system. substantial saving in energy, dye, chemical, and water/sewer requirements demonstrated, and cost/benefit analyses based on the pilot-scale data and industrial information indicate a recovery of capital investment of less than one year for all of the systems investigated on incorporation of dyebath/auxiliary bath reuse. 14 refs
